Before I lived in Phuket full-time, one of the main reasons I would visit the island is to play golf. It was a great place to get away for a few days, or when I had more time off from work, a couple of weeks. If you are sat at home now trying to decide where to book your next golf holiday, I would like to share with you what I liked most about visiting Phuket to play golf.
Caddies and hospitality
I am from the UK, so carrying our own clubs around the course is standard. It can be a lonely and desolate game if you don't have a playing partner, and that's why I love playing golf in Phuket. To play all the courses on the island, you need a caddy who carries your clubs, cleans your balls, gives you solid advice regarding yardage and putting slopes while at the same time providing you with company.

The hospitality of Phuket golf courses is world-class. From the gracious staff and the course facilities that have restaurants, changing rooms, swimming pools, and even spas in some cases, the caddies and hospitality on Phuket courses is unparalleled.
The variety of courses
The choice of courses is also something I really like. If I just want to play 9-holes, I can visit Phunaka GC. If I am looking for a challenge, the island's two championship courses, Red Mountain and the Canyon Course at Blue Canyon CC are world-class. There are also a host of other courses that make up the middle ground such as Phuket Country Club, Laguna Phuket GC and Mission Hills Phuket. There is something for every person and mood.

Lots of things to do at night
A golf holiday for me is nothing if I don't have things to do when I am not playing. Phuket has a hedonistic array of nightlife charms with lots of bars, clubs and restaurants right across the island, but mainly in Patong, Kata, Karon, Kamala, Surin and Raawi. Because Phuket is such a popular world-class holiday destination, there are lots of things to do day or night when not playing golf.
